59 lines
1.4 KiB
TypeScript
59 lines
1.4 KiB
TypeScript
// Interface automatically generated by schemas-to-ts
|
|
|
|
export interface YogaContactUs {
|
|
id: number;
|
|
attributes: {
|
|
createdAt: Date; updatedAt: Date; publishedAt?: Date; title?: string;
|
|
header?: string;
|
|
firstName?: string;
|
|
lastName?: string;
|
|
phone?: string;
|
|
email?: string;
|
|
message?: string;
|
|
buttonText?: string;
|
|
locale: string;
|
|
localizations?: { data: YogaContactUs[] };
|
|
};
|
|
}
|
|
export interface YogaContactUs_Plain {
|
|
id: number;
|
|
createdAt: Date; updatedAt: Date; publishedAt?: Date; title?: string;
|
|
header?: string;
|
|
firstName?: string;
|
|
lastName?: string;
|
|
phone?: string;
|
|
email?: string;
|
|
message?: string;
|
|
buttonText?: string;
|
|
locale: string;
|
|
localizations?: YogaContactUs_Plain[];
|
|
}
|
|
|
|
export interface YogaContactUs_NoRelations {
|
|
id: number;
|
|
createdAt: Date; updatedAt: Date; publishedAt?: Date; title?: string;
|
|
header?: string;
|
|
firstName?: string;
|
|
lastName?: string;
|
|
phone?: string;
|
|
email?: string;
|
|
message?: string;
|
|
buttonText?: string;
|
|
locale: string;
|
|
localizations?: YogaContactUs[];
|
|
}
|
|
|
|
export interface YogaContactUs_AdminPanelLifeCycle {
|
|
id: number;
|
|
createdAt: Date; updatedAt: Date; publishedAt?: Date; title?: string;
|
|
header?: string;
|
|
firstName?: string;
|
|
lastName?: string;
|
|
phone?: string;
|
|
email?: string;
|
|
message?: string;
|
|
buttonText?: string;
|
|
locale: string;
|
|
localizations?: YogaContactUs[];
|
|
}
|